ROME. New episode in the cold war, but now almost hot, between the Minister of Justice, Carlo Nordio, and his former colleagues, the Italian magistrates. By now we are on the verge of invective, thanks to the disciplinary action that Nordio would like to activate against the three Milan judges who had sent the Russian fixer Artem Uss under house arrest. And it is on the edge of sarcasm. “Nothing is further than this affair from the liberal guarantee policies that many expected and in which some still trust, perhaps not to recognize the error of early enthusiasms that should have died out given the facts, and not now,” he says the president of the National Association of Magistrates, Giuseppe Santalucia, accompanied by the full consent of the steering committee of the ANM.

Obviously here the champion of liberal guaranteeism, not mentioned, should have been Nordio. But for the magistrates the story of Milan represents the unveiling of the true face of the minister. So goodbye to early enthusiasm.

Santalucia continues: “It cannot be kept silent that the indictment leveled against the magistrates of the Court of Appeal of Milan, in the terms in which it was built, is deliberately and evidently placed outside the confines in which the exercise of ministerial power is constitutionally permitted and required. A judge, a collegiate judge, is accused of not having fully accepted the deductions of the public prosecutor, no one envisages or even sketches a description of grave and inexcusable negligence”.

In practice, according to the top of the ANM, but of the entire Milanese judiciary, and not only, the minister is attacking independence and autonomy. And it concludes: “The Italian judiciary is ready and attentive, as always and without suffering any tiredness, in the reaffirmation not of its privileges but, allow me and it is by no means a joke, of the privileges that democracy ensures to the entire community”.

Almost a declaration of war. On the other hand, in Parliament, at the end of last April, Nordio himself had announced a battle, when he said: “No one can afford to charge the minister with invasive interference when he exercises his prerogatives to verify the compliance of the behavior of the magistrates with the duties of diligence . It is the duty of the ministry to proceed with the same criteria with which the prosecutors send the guarantee information to the citizens against whom they carry out the investigations “.
